Relive the Hope that fueled a nation in a mesmerizing show presenting the story of Israel's national anthem. A unique multi-media show based on a revolutionary research. Now celebrating its 400 performance!
Whether you know a little, a lot, or nothing at all about Hatikva - you will be entertained, enlightened and inspired by virtuoso pianist and scholar Dr. Astrith Baltsan in a spectacular performance containing music by Mozart, Chopin and Smetana; Jewish and Israeli folk, pop and rock tunes; Rare archival recordings and historical video clips.
